Reconnecting Communities through Creative Infrastructure

The recently constructed Beehive Bridge in New Britain, Connecticut, and winner of the American Council of Engineering Companies (ACEC) Engineering Excellence National Merit Award, is a testament to the power of structures to connect people and connect to people. The Beehive Bridge reconnects long-divided neighborhoods, encourages pedestrian use, and represents its community through its singular design (Figure 1).
